A Mr. Eel,[1] also simply called an Eel,[2] is a small Snorkel Snake-like enemy that appears in Yoshi's Story. Mr. Eels are seen only in stages with water, namely Jungle Puddle and Lots O'Fish. These enemies do nothing but mindlessly swim through levels, moving through walls and other obstacles; as a result, they do not pose much of a threat. Mr. Eels always come in unlimited numbers, which can prove to be useful, as they can be eaten by a Yoshi to restore life on the latter's Smile Meter. When a Yoshi eats a Mr. Eel, it gives them an egg, but it is useless underwater.
